Forrest Fenn figured he had dodged death plenty of times. He launched his famous treasure hunt in 2010, in the face of a cancer diagnosis when he thought the disease would kill him for sure. Long before that, there were combat flights as a pilot during wars in Korea and Vietnam. ip search resources https://fatlineproductions.com

Forrest Fenn (90) passed away from natural causes in his home in Santa Fe, NM. Fenn was raised in Temple, TX, where his father was a school principal.
